The Subanon are one of the earliest indigenous peoples of Mindanao, originally living along rivers but now primarily in the mountains, practicing agriculture and maintaining rich cultural traditions. They speak Subanen, an Austronesian language with various dialects, and face challenges such as loss of ancestral land, cultural erosion, poverty, and discrimination. Despite these issues, they continue to uphold their spiritual beliefs and community practices.
